WARNING! Risk of injury to the user / patient
Before submitting a patient to lung ventilation, it is good practice to:
7-2
The correct setting of respiratory parameters and alarms limits, as
well as the selection of most suitable ventilation modality are not
described in the present manual.
The choice of the operation modalities and alarm limits most
suitable for the physiological conditions and pathologies of the
patient under anaesthesia, it will be up to the User.
For the safety of users and patients, before making operative the
MORPHEUS LT/MRI anaesthesia unit, you should have performed
a series of checks and inspections.
Consult the present User's Manual
Perform correctly all the foreseen preliminary controls (cfr. 6)
Prepare the flowmeter box for operation
Set the respiratory physiological parameters most suitable for the
patient's clinical conditions.
Set the logic and the limits of the alarms
set the limit of airways pressure (high PAW at values not higher
than 30 cmH
O; this to avoid problems due to a wrong setting of
2
volume or respiratory rate (the pressure could be increased
whenever required by the pathology and the patient's conditions);
